Awards

Military Medal (Hill 70)
Description: Froom the Regimental Diary:
On 16/8/17, on Hill 70, after the capture of the CHALK PIT, this man was one of a party detailed to expel an enemy party. The N.C.O. was wounded and the supply of bombs ran out, but this soldier and one other held their ground and successfully beat the enemy off with rifle fire. He also assisted to construct a block in the communications trench.
